Remarks Not sure if I answered the questions correctly but we saw it go across the sky from our deck when we were facing West, towards Santa Cruz, and it appeared to come from the North East, come across the sky and look to descend South, towards the Central Coast. We then heard a low boom once it descended. It was an orange ball that was very visible
